A Simple Poem, A Simple Word

The light of a new day has shownwoman-in-worship-2
That our God is still upon His throne.
We lift up our eyes to behold
The resurrection of Jesus brought us into His fold.
No more shall we look down at the ground.
Because of him we’ve been found.
No more do we wallow in sin.
Because now we are His kin.
We are now made to sit in Heavenly places.
His countenance shall reflect in our faces.
Then go forth into this land
And spread the Word as only you can
There’s someone waiting for you to say
Salvation was meant for you this day.
